Description
We proudly produce award winning beers of the Last Frontier! Winner of 2 gold and 7 bronze medals from the Brewers Associations’ Great American Beer Festival as well as a silver and bronze medal from the World Beer Cup.
We are are a production brewery, and are not open to the public. You can find our beers at Moose's Tooth Pub & Pizzeria, as well as the Bear Tooth Theatrepub & Grill.
